NAME Audio::Scan - Fast C scanning of audio file metadata SYNOPSIS use Audio::Scan; my $data = Audio::Scan->scan('/path/to/file.mp3'); # Just file info my $info = Audio::Scan->scan_info('/path/to/file.mp3'); # Just tags my $tags = Audio::Scan->scan_tags('/path/to/file.mp3'); DESCRIPTION Audio::Scan is a C-based scanner for audio file metadata and tag information. It currently supports MP3 via an included version of libid3tag, Ogg Vorbis, and FLAC (if libFLAC is installed). A future release will add support for AAC, WMA, WAV, and possibly others. See below for specific details about each file format. METHODS scan( $path ) Scans $path for both metadata and tag information. The type of scan performed is determined by the file's extension. Supported extensions are: MP3: mp3, mp2 Ogg: ogg, oga FLAC: flc, flac, fla This method returns a hashref containing two other hashrefs: info and tags. The contents of the info and tag hashes vary depending on file format, see below for details. scan_info( $path ) If you only need file metadata and don't care about tags, you can use this method. scan_tags( $path ) If you only need the tags and don't care about the metadata, use this method. MP3 DETAILS INFO The following metadata about a file may be returned: id3_version (i.e. "ID3v2.4.0") song_length_ms (duration in milliseconds) layer (i.e. 3) stereo samples_per_frame padding audio_size (size of all audio frames) audio_offset (byte offset to first audio frame) bitrate (in bps, determined using Xing/LAME/VBRI if possible, or average in the worst case) samplerate (in kHz) vbr (1 if file is VBR) If a Xing header is found: xing_frames xing_bytes xing_quality If a VBRI header is found: vbri_delay vbri_frames vbri_bytes vbri_quality If a LAME header is found: lame_encoder_version lame_tag_revision lame_vbr_method lame_lowpass lame_replay_gain_radio lame_replay_gain_audiophile lame_encoder_delay lame_encoder_padding lame_noise_shaping lame_stereo_mode lame_unwise_settings lame_source_freq lame_surround lame_preset TAGS Raw tags are returned as found by libid3tag. This means older tags such as ID3v1 and ID3v2.2 are converted to ID3v2.4 tag names. Multiple instances of a tag in a file will be returned as arrays. Complex tags such as APIC and COMM are returned as arrays. All tag fields are converted to upper-case. Sample tag data: tags => { ALBUMARTISTSORT => "Solar Fields", APIC => [ 0, "image/jpeg", 3, "", ], CATALOGNUMBER => "INRE 017", COMM => [0, "eng", "", "Amazon.com Song ID: 202981429"], "MUSICBRAINZ ALBUM ARTIST ID" => "a2af1f31-c9eb-4fff-990c-c4f547a11b75", "MUSICBRAINZ ALBUM ID" => "282143c9-6191-474d-a31a-1117b8c88cc0", "MUSICBRAINZ ALBUM RELEASE COUNTRY" => "FR", "MUSICBRAINZ ALBUM STATUS" => "official", "MUSICBRAINZ ALBUM TYPE" => "album", "MUSICBRAINZ ARTIST ID" => "a2af1f31-c9eb-4fff-990c-c4f547a11b75", "REPLAYGAIN_ALBUM_GAIN" => "-2.96 dB", "REPLAYGAIN_ALBUM_PEAK" => "1.045736", "REPLAYGAIN_TRACK_GAIN" => "+3.60 dB", "REPLAYGAIN_TRACK_PEAK" => "0.892606", TALB => "Leaving Home", TCOM => "Magnus Birgersson", TCON => "Ambient", TCOP => "2005 ULTIMAE RECORDS", TDRC => "2004-10", TIT2 => "Home", TPE1 => "Solar Fields", TPE2 => "Solar Fields", TPOS => "1/1", TPUB => "Ultimae Records", TRCK => "1/11", TSOP => "Solar Fields", UFID => [ "http://musicbrainz.org", "1084278a-2254-4613-a03c-9fed7a8937ca", ], }, OGG VORBIS INFO The following metadata about a file is returned: version channels stereo samplerate (in kHz) bitrate_average (in bps) bitrate_upper bitrate_nominal bitrate_lower blocksize_0 blocksize_1 audio_offset (byte offset to audio) song_length_ms (duration in milliseconds) TAGS Raw Vorbis comments are returned. All comment keys are capitalized. FLAC INFO The following metadata about a file is returned: channels samplerate (in kHz) bitrate (in bps) file_size audio_offset (byte offset to audio) song_length_ms (duration in milliseconds) bits_per_sample frames minimum_blocksize maximum_blocksize minimum_framesize maximum_framesize md5 total_samples TAGS Raw FLAC comments are returned. All comment keys are capitalized. Some data returned is special: APPLICATION Each application block is returned in the APPLICATION tag keyed by application ID. CUESHEET The CUESHEET tag is an array containing each line of the cue sheet. PICTURE Embedded pictures are returned in an ALLPICTURES array. Each picture has the following metadata: mime_type description width height depth color_index image_data picture_type THANKS Some of the file format parsing code was derived from the mt-daapd project, and adapted by Netgear.
